What are the dangers of wisdom tooth extraction during breastfeeding? The biggest concern about tooth extraction during breastfeeding is cross infection, so when mothers choose a hospital, they must make sure that the hygiene conditions are met. Otherwise, if an infection occurs during breastfeeding, the infected bacteria may be transmitted to the baby, and the consequences will be disastrous. Therefore, hygiene is particularly important, and mothers should not ignore this detail because of convenience and other factors. If the mother is really uncomfortable during breastfeeding and must have her wisdom teeth removed, she must go to a regular hospital for treatment and must tell the doctor that she is breastfeeding and let the doctor tell her which medicines she cannot take. Follow the doctor's advice. After all, once a mother is infected with bacteria, it will definitely harm her breastfeeding baby. |
